`
Action-人生
  • 浏览: 105687 次
  • 性别: Icon_minigender_1
  • 来自: 南京
社区版块
存档分类
最新评论
文章列表
1、获取正在执行的sql语句、sql语句的执行时间、sql语句的等待事件: select a.sql_text,b.status,b.last_call_et,b.machine,b.event,b.program from v$sql a,v$session b where a.sql_id=b.sql_id 2、获取sql语句执行时间: select sql_text,cpu_time/1000/1000 t_cpu,trunc(elapsed_time/1000/1000) t_elapse from v$sql 但是并不是所有的sql语句都可以从v$sql中得到,因为oracle ...
select * from (select sql_text,sql_id,cpu_time from v$sql order by cpu_time desc) where rownum<=10 order by       rownum asc ; select * from (select sql_text,sql_id,cpu_time from v$sqlarea order by cpu_time desc) where rownum<=10 order by rownum asc ; 这2个语句效果基本一样,一个从v$sql视图查询一个从v$sqlarea视图查询。 ...

LInux tar压缩解压

tar命令是类Linux中比价常用的解压与压缩命令。 可以使用命令 (man tar) 命令来进行查看man的基本命令。下面举例说明一下tar 的基本命令。 #tar -cvf     sysconfig.tar    /etc/sysconfig 命令解释:将目录/etc/sysconfig/目录下的文件打包成 ...
submit()和execute()的区别 JDK5往后,任务分两类:一类是实现了Runnable接口的类,一类是实现了Callable接口的类。两者都可以被ExecutorService执行,它们的区别是: execute(Runnable x) 没有返回值。可以执行任务,但无法判断任务是否成功完成。——实现Runnable接口 submit(Runnable x) 返回一个future。可以用这个future来判断任务是否成功完成。——实现Callable接口 --------------------- 作者:~哀而不伤 来源:CSDN 原文:https://blog.csdn.ne ...
最近在看并发编程,在使用到ThreadPoolExecutor时,对它的三个关闭方法(shutdown()、shutdownNow()、awaitTermination())产生了兴趣,同时又感到迷惑。查了些资料,自己写了测试代码,总算有了个比较清晰的认识。下面一起来看看这三个 ...
https://www.cnblogs.com/stonefeng/p/5967451.html 在使用多线程的时候有时候我们会使用 java.util.concurrent.Executors的线程池,当多个线程异步执行的时候,我们往往不好判断是否线程池中所有的子线程都已经执行完毕,但有时候这种判断却很有用,例如我有个方法的功能是往一个文件异步地写入内容,我需要在所有的子线程写入完毕后在文件末尾写“---END---”及关闭文件流等,这个时候我就需要某个标志位可以告诉我是否线程池中所有的子线程都已经执行完毕,我使用这种方式来判断。 public class MySemaphore {    ...

JAVA方法可变参数

    博客分类:
  • JAVA
参考来自于别人,   ---定义可变参数方法--- public class ValTest{   public static int valibarParams(int... items){  }   public  static int getLagerNum(int number,int... items){} } ---调用可变参数方法--- 1:调用可以不传参数 System.out.println("不传参数valibarParams:"+ValTest.valibarParams()); 2:调用传入若干参数 System.out.println(" ...
通过SSH或者SecureCRTPortable等可以直接连接Linux操作系统的软件,连接到Linux系统。 这里我使用的是SecureCRTPortable。个人感觉还是挺好用的。 1.连接到Linux服务器(输入服务器的ip地址) ssh 10.199.94.227 2.登录到Linux后,就可以在命令窗口直接对Linux进行操作了。 这里我们先将用户切换到Oracle。当显示为[oracle@db ~]$ 时,说明切换成功。 命令:su - oracle 注意事项:一定要注意su后和-后都有空格哦。 3.切换到Oracle用户之后,我们登录到到sqlplus。 首先我们 ...
来源于https://blog.csdn.net/HelloJave/article/details/83145719 java编译和类加载详述 Java程序运行时,必须经过编译和运行两个步骤。首先将后缀名为.java的源文件进行编译,最终生成后缀名为.class的字节码文件。然后Java虚拟机将编译好的字 ...
IE浏览器,进行文件上传下载rseponseBody返回json弹出下载框,原因在于ie浏览器不能识别 application/json;charset=UTF-8类型json 首先了解概念 text/html & text/plain的区别    Content-Type:用于定义用户的浏览器或相关设备如何显示将要加载的数据,或者如何处理将要加载的数据   MIME:MIME类型就是设定某种扩展名的文件用一种应用程序来打开的方式类型,当该扩展名文件被访问的时候,浏览器会自动使用指定应用程序来打开。多用于指定一些客户端自定义的文件名,以及一些媒体文件打开方式。 text/html的意思是 ...

Extjs 控件属性大全

ext 
Ext.form.TimeField:   配置项:            maxValue:列表中允许的最大时间            maxText:当时间大于最大值时的错误提示信息            minValue:列表中允许的最小时间            minText:当时间小于最小值时的错误提示信息            increment:两个相邻选项间的时间间隔,默认为15分钟            format:显示格式,默认为“g:i A”。一般使用“H:i:s”                 H:带前缀0的24小时                ...
store是一个为Ext器件提供record对象的存储容器,行为和属性都很象数据表 方法:不列举继承来的方法 Store( Object config ) 构造,config定义为{ autoLoad : Boolean/Object,    //自动载入 baseParams : Object,    //只有使用httpproxy时才有意义 data : Array,        //数据 proxy : Ext.data.DataProxy,//数据代理 pruneModifiedRecords : boolean,//清除修改信息 reader : Ext.data.Re ...
activiti工作流的驳回等功能的封装 http://blog.csdn.net/x9x9x9x9/article/details/9200329 中国人的流程习惯是有来有往,能审批通过就应该能驳回。即可驳回到流程线上任意一节点,而国外的流程引擎思想这点与国内差别很大,为了满足国内 ...
x-requested-with 请求头 区分ajax请求还是普通请求 在服务器端判断request来自Ajax请求(异步)还是传统请求(同步):   两种请求在请求的Header不同,Ajax 异步请求比传统的同步请求多了一个头参数   1、传统同步请求参数     a ...
box-sizing box-sizing 属性允许您以特定的方式定义匹配某个区域的特定元素。 语法 box-sizing:content-box | border-box 默认值:content-box 取值 content-box: padding和border不被包含在定义的width和height之内。对象的实际宽度等于设置的width值和bo ...
Global site tag (gtag.js) - Google Analytics